Straining (Noun)

Meaning 1

The act of distorting something so it seems to mean something it was not intended to mean.

Classification

Nouns denoting acts or actions.

Synonyms

  • Distortion
  • Overrefinement
  • Twisting
  • Torture

Hypernyms

  • Falsification
  • Misrepresentation

Meaning 2

An intense or violent exertion.

Classification

Nouns denoting acts or actions.

Examples

  • The athlete's face was contorted in straining as she heaved the massive weight overhead.
  • His muscles were visibly straining under the weight of the heavy box he was trying to lift.
  • The firemen were straining against the doors to force them open and rescue those trapped inside.
  • After several minutes of straining, the rock climber finally reached the top of the cliff.
  • The hikers were straining up the steep mountain trail, their legs burning with fatigue.

Synonyms

  • Strain

Hypernyms

  • Effort
  • Travail
  • Exertion
  • Sweat
